Journal: :Neuron 2002
Matthew P. Walker Tiffany Brakefield Alexandra Morgan J.Allan Hobson Robert Stickgold

Improvement in motor skill performance is known to continue for at least 24 hr following training, yet the relative contributions of time spent awake and asleep are unknown. Here we provide evidence that a night of sleep results in a 20% increase in motor speed without loss of accuracy, while an equivalent period of time during wake provides no significant benefit. Journal: :Research in developmental disabilities 2014
Simone V Gill Ya-Ching Hung

Little is known about how obesity relates to motor planning and skills during functional tasks. We collected 3-D kinematics and kinetics as normal weight (n=10) and overweight/obese (n=12) children walked on flat ground and as they crossed low, medium, and high obstacles.
